  • Court: Russia must compensate Pussy Riot

    Court: Russia must compensate Pussy Riot

    strasbourg July 17, 2018 11:06 Hot Recent News

    Russia has to pay three members of Pussy Riot a compensation of thousands of euros. The European Court of Human Rights (ECtHR) ruled that the rights of women have been repeatedly violated during their trial. The activists would also have been disproportionately severely punished.

  • G7: Russia needs to clarify MH17

    G7: Russia needs to clarify MH17

    ottawa July 15, 2018 20:06 Hot Recent News

    The Foreign Ministers of the G7 countries have called on Russia to provide clarification on the crash of the MH17 passenger plane. The Boeing was brought down from Schiphol to Malaysia in July 2014 by an anti-aircraft missile in eastern Ukraine. All 298 occupants died. Among them were 196 Dutch.

  • London asks help Russia in case Novitsjok

    London asks help Russia in case Novitsjok

    london/the hague July 5, 2018 09:51 Hot Recent News

    The British government has called on Russia to clarify the poison novitsjok that has re-emerged in the south of England. The latest incident in which a British couple is hospitalized in a critical condition follows the poisoning in March of a Russian ex-spy Sergej Skripal and his daughter. The nerve gas Novitsjok was once developed in the Soviet Union as a weapon of mass destruction.
